Lao army and China hold joint military drill in Laos

VIENTIANE, May 12 (Xinhua): China and Laos launched a joint military exercise on Thursday at the Kommadam Academy of the Lao People's Armed Forces (LPAF) in Laos, aimed at enhancing capabilities of the two militaries to combat terrorism.

Major-General Yang Wenlin, deputy commander of the 75th Group Army of the Chinese People's Liberation Army (PLA) Southern Theater Command, said the China-Laos Friendship Shield-2023 joint exercise serves as a platform for exchanging experiences between the two militaries, as well as a concrete measure to deepen friendship and boost cooperation between the two countries.
